Rebecca Romijn
'''Rebecca Alie O'Connell ( , ; formerly Romijn-Stamos'''; born November 6, 1972) is an American actress and former model. She is known for her role as Mystique in the original trilogy (2000–2006) of the ''X-Men'' film series, as Joan from ''The Punisher'' (2004) (both based on Marvel Comics), the dual roles of Laure Ash and Lily Watts in ''Femme Fatale'' (2002), and Una Chin-Riley on ''Star Trek: Discovery'' (2019) and ''Star Trek: Strange New Worlds'' (2022 - present). She has also had a recurring role as Alexis Meade on the ABC television series ''Ugly Betty''. Her other major roles include Eve Baird on the TNT series ''The Librarians'', voicing Lois Lane in the DC Animated Movie Universe, and as the host of the reality competition show ''Skin Wars''.
